Transaction 75b7d4385ede6fda39a4906c2dbefbfc0ae253692061fcb63569f6e9f45033d8
1 Input
1 Output
-
75b7d4385ede6fda39a4906c2dbefbfc0ae253692061fcb63569f6e9f45033d8:0
- value
- 1789730
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d97414c4aa513cdae879605e690faa10dc3f4e3
- address
- bc1qmkt5znz255fumt58jcz7dy865yxu8a8re0f9rh